odd TDC cylinder position
I have a strange problem with my ap2 motor, apparently this is the highest point in which the cylinders reach the top of cylinder walls. It look's like it can still go up another 5/16's of an inch. I tore my engine down to replace the cylinder rings and a new head gasket due to all cylinders being at 185psi and cylinder 4 being at 85psi. I had a valve job done a year ago and my vehicle had loss of power and misfiring. Valve job fixed the misfire, but low end continued to have little to no power. The mechanic said that the block may have ap1 piston and rods because the cylinder did not reach all the way to the top. I confirmed that the rods and pistons are ap2 because they have "PZX" stampings on them. Maybe the crank is AP1? If you can help, please reply.
